I recently returned to the Warhammer 40k Hobby after a 10+ years hiatus, and now have started to give painting my minis a try.
I never was a good painter to begin with, but I think these turned out okay for a first start. It's also to show off the colors of my custom chapter.
Blood Red and Mithril Silver are the main colors used, and I think they go very well together. The bases are still unpainted, but that will still change.
This is a rather fast style without any fancy techniques. It's how I want my regular tacticals to look. I'll keep the more complicated stuff for more special units - Terminators, independent characters, vehicles and the like.

Also, I prime depending on how much work I expect to put in the mini. Normal Tacticals and other minis that I want to do fast are primed white, while some of the more impressive minis (Terminators, Characters, etc.) and all vehicles I prime black. You can actually see them in the background of this pic.
I'll definitely stock up on some washes now. Maybe I'll test the black one I have already on the metal for now and see how that turns out. I'm especially curious to see how those look on the very bright mithral silver.
